Leros Island Beaches

Leros Island Beaches


There are both frequented and secluded beaches in Leros. Agia Marina, Vromolithos and Alinda are the most organized Leros beaches, while there are many other quiet places to relax around the island. Over the last years, Leros is developing as a popular scuba diving destination due to its rich seabed. You will find below a list with the best beaches in Leros island.
Alinda Beach

Alinda Beach

Alinda is located 3 km north west of Agia Marina and is the longest beach of Leros. Also this is one of the best organized areas with numerous facilities, leisure activities, plenty of water sports and fish taverns.

Agia Marina Beach

Agia Marina Beach

Vromolithos Beach

Vromolithos Beach

Vromolithos is a beautiful cove located in the southeast of Pandeli village. During the last years, it has developed into a tourist resort with many villas and various accommodation types.

Blefoutis Beach

Blefoutis Beach

Blefoutis beach lies on the natural bay of the same name, on the northern side of Leros. This sandy beach overlooks the landlocked bay and is very calm and picturesque, with its tamarisk-tree surrounding.

Dioliskaria Beach

Dioliskaria Beach

Dioliskaria beach offers comfortable facilities for tourists and has managed to remain unspoilt through the pass of time. It is located 7 km north of Platanos, the capital of Leros.

Ksirokampos Beach

Ksirokampos Beach

Xirokambos beach is located around a natural bay, 9 km southeast of Agia Marina, part of the capital of Leros and 3 km far from the natural port of Lakki.

Tonys Beach

Tonys Beach

The picturesque beach of Tonnys lies on the bay of Panteli, a beautiful settlement 2 km south of Platanos, the capital of Leros.

Gourna Beach

Gourna Beach

The wide and large bay of Gourna lies 7 km west of Platanos, the capital of Leros. It is one of the longest beaches of the island.

Merikia Beach

Merikia Beach

Merikia Beach is coiled up on the Bay of Lakki 6 km south of the capital of Leros. It is a peaceful sandy beach surrounded by tamarisk trees, overlooking the broad natural bay.
